While I'm on the subject of useless and annoying features, how about those up- and down-voting buttons to the left of thread posts?  When people use these, it changes the order of the posts in the thread.  Many times, though, one post is a reply or an addition to a previous one.  By re-ordering the posts in the thread, it makes it difficult to follow the thread's internal developmental logic.

I vote for eliminating the Vote buttons.  Or at least, use them to only record the number of votes, not to change the order of the posts.

The vote buttons are a poor substitute for the old system of having the OP mark an answer as "correct" or at least "accepted".  I agree that they are easily used as a trolling system.  That not only messes up the results but, because of the restacking, makes it very hard to follow a thread here.  I would be very surprised if there were a way to get rid of the voting buttons, but it would be very nice if LL could find a way to let us view posts in chronological order.
